Transaction 217786f94ef26a616f48c6c30e6f7b454226ecf2633ff5fad69268cd837adf61
1 Input
2 Outputs
- 217786f94ef26a616f48c6c30e6f7b454226ecf2633ff5fad69268cd837adf61:0
- 217786f94ef26a616f48c6c30e6f7b454226ecf2633ff5fad69268cd837adf61:1
value 526904
address 1Ek82cbnR4rJ45DeqH6q5eDEQ4gQZzJpEp
value 406904
address 3AEoG5MfH71dtcixZ37ZdVWk7M83YM7M8p